What to Expect in a Fine Arts Course

1. Art History and Theory:

You’ll delve into the rich history and theory of art, gaining a deeper understanding of art movements, styles, and the artists who shaped the course of art history.

2. Studio Work:

A significant part of a fine arts course involves practical work in a studio environment. You’ll have access to art materials and resources, allowing you to experiment with different techniques, mediums, and styles.

3. Critiques and Feedback:

Courses often involve peer critiques and feedback sessions, where you can present your work, receive constructive criticism, and learn from your peers.

4. Exhibitions:

Many fine arts courses culminate in student exhibitions, providing you with a platform to showcase your work to a wider audience, garner recognition, and make connections in the art world.

Career Opportunities

1. Professional Artist:

Completing a fine arts course can pave the way for a career as a professional artist, where you create and sell your art through galleries, exhibitions, and online platforms.

2. Art Educator:

You can pursue a career as an art educator, sharing your knowledge and passion for art with students of all ages, from elementary schools to higher education institutions.

3. Art Therapist:

Art therapy is a growing field that uses art as a means of therapy and self-expression. Completing a fine arts course can be a stepping stone toward a career as an art therapist.
